  2. N ★★★★★

    Tesco vs Costco In my view Tesco gives a far better experience. Tesco is large British retailer; Costco is a massive US retailer. Opening hours: Tesco 24 hours, Costco just 11-2030. Checkout: Tesco: normal, self-scan or scan as you go, Costco: just normal. Costco also makes the customer queue twice, a disorganised queue at the checkouts, then again on exit. Since Costco Reading offered petrol, it has been a horrible, far too crowded experience. Parking: Both have plenty of parking, although the parking can be further from the Tesco store. Price: Costco prices are about the same as Tesco own brand, (not counting offers), but for Costco you have to pay a membership fee and can only buy in bulk.

  1. Sara Westwood ★★★☆☆

    I’m writing about the click and collect service from this Chineham Supermarket. I give it 3 stars because when ordering there are no instructions sent telling you where to collect the items other than you need a smartphone. Indeed you DO NEED a smartphone when collecting. On arriving at the store we had to ask 2 members of staff where click and collect was. The first person didn’t know. We were told it was in the top car park. After walking up to the car park there was no signage that said Tesco Click and Collect. I had to ask a trolley collector and I was pointed to an area where there was a purple sign saying entry. No mention of Tesco click and collect. I then saw some shoppers queuing and asked what we then had to do. They directed me to a red QR code reader. Again no labelling to say it was linked to Tesco Click and collect. The reader worked and then the phone asked me to confirm name and car registration number. We were on foot as we collecting 2 items! I was able to enter NONE. Having got through that part of the process we were in a queue and waited about 10-15 minutes for our items to appear. If we had not seen anybody in the top car park to ask we would not have had a clue what to do. I hope this review helps people doing click and collect for the first time. I’ll stick to my Sainsbury’s online ordering in the future. It just happens that Tesco sell a particular gammon on the bone product only they sell and is excellent for Christmas time.
